Abstract

Scientific research and publication of the scientific paper are two activities closely related. Scientific Research ends with the publication of the scientific paper; only then it will become part of the scientific knowledge. This paper addresses issues such as the definition of a scientific paper, general principles for writing as well as the different parts that make up the structure of an original scientific paper.

The development of socio-emotional skills in students has become a current topic in current education. This article analyzes various effective strategies to strengthen these competencies in the school environment. The importance of promoting skills such as emotional intelligence, empathy, self-regulation and decision making is highlighted, since these skills have been shown to be fundamental for the emotional well-being and academic and social success of students. Practical strategies, such as social-emotional education programs, experiential learning activities, and the inclusion of these competencies in the curriculum, are described in detail. In addition, the relevance of collaboration between parents, educators and the community in general is emphasized to promote a supportive environment that encourages the development of social-emotional competencies in students. Regarding the results, it was proven that the effective implementation of these strategies can have a positive impact on the comprehensive training of students and on the preparation of future emotionally intelligent and socially competent citizens. The best strategy to use to strengthen socio-emotional competencies in students is the use of didactic and motivational strategies, since they allow the teaching and learning processes to be guided, favoring collaborative work in those who lack these competencies.

One of the main problems in developing writing skills in English with a Genre approach is to write an Abstract about articles or scientific researches. With the objective to update the knowledge about this theme it was decided to do a bibliographical revision about the most important elements related to this kind of text. In this paper is described the ways of production of the abstract text, it is also analyzed the relation between reading and writing skills, the text information, the discourse information, the genre approach and the different kinds of abstracts, basically medical researches. As a result of the revision done it is suggested to use the model stated by the Dutch linguist Teun A. Van Dijk due to its efficacy in researches done by most of the authors consulted in articles and books about this theme. It is concluded that the aspects that should be taken into consideration to write an abstract in english are: the activities or macrorules, also called resunctive operations: elliciting, selecting, generalizing, constructing or integrating, as well as the linguistic analysis of the research articles: length of the abstracts, number and length of statements used, voice and verbal tenses.
